Specifications
Primary Voltage 120 V
Secondary 1 140 V @ 100 mA
Secondary 2 28 V @ 20 mA
Secondary 3 10.5 V @ 2 A

Primary voltage = black wires Secondary 1 = Red wires Secondary 2 = Yellow wires Secondary 3 = Green wires

The lead wires are quite short 0.9" ( 140VAC & 10.5VAC). The remaining secondary leads are 5.0" and the primary leads are only 3.0". Therefore it is necessary to splice additional wires onto the leads. Be careful when you do this as all the leads are very stiff. I wasn't careful enough and the result was an open primary winding. Fortunately I was able to repair the primary (the lead wire separated from the winding).

Otherwise the transformer appears be well built. I'll know more when I get my power supply design working.
